How campsite cancellation alerts work

A booked campground does not always stay booked. Cancellations, changed plans, and released inventory can create another chance.

Why cancellations matter

Campground reservations change as people cancel trips, modify dates, miss deadlines, or release extra nights. Official policies vary by facility and booking platform, so campers should always check the rules before booking.

What an alert should include

A useful alert should tell you the campground, campsite, date range, number of open matches, and where to book. Crowded Camper keeps the booking step official by linking back to the reservation platform.

Why filters help

Alerts are better when they match the trip you can actually take. Date ranges, arrival days, minimum nights, and campsite type filters keep alerts from becoming noise.
